好的,我怀疑这个错误与postgres有关。但我不确定。
我在admin中遇到了一个endcoding错误:
UnicodeEncodeError at /admin/catalogos/tipoidfiscal/2/
指向“Cédula”这个词,它直接从数据库中作为错误的来源。该单词存储在模型中的Charfield
中。
奇怪的是,如果我在本地工作,我不会收到错误,只会在Heroku
上发生。 :/?¿?
另外,我对本地数据库pg_backup
和远程pg_restore
上的Heroku Postgres
进行了操作。当我做pg_dump
时,我可能没有为数据库设置正确的编码?我不知道,我有点迷失在这里。我如何检查它是否是数据库,或者它不是数据库,错误在哪里?